S. 4653 (116th)

A bill to protect the healthcare of hundreds of millions of people of the United States and prevent efforts of the Department of Justice to advocate courts to strike down the Patient Protection and Affordable Care Act.

Summary

This bill prohibits the Department of Justice from advocating that a court invalidate any provision of the Patient Protection and Affordable Care Act.
